Pitt Panthers quarterback (1979-1982) Dan Marino conferring with Coaches Jackie Sherrill and Joe Pendry. Jackie Sherrill came to the Panthers with Head Coach Johnny Majors and served as Assistant Head Coach from 1973 to 1976. He was made Head Coach in 1977 when Majors left for the University of Tennessee. By his sixth season as Head Coach he achieved a 50-9-1 record. His last game as coach for Pitt was November 1, 1982. Joe Pendry served as part of the Panthers coaching staff in 1978 as a Quarterbacks Coach and in 1979 as Offensive Line Coach. Dan Marino led Pitt to four consecutive Top Ten AP Poll finishes and four Bowl game appearances. His jersey was retired by Pitt at the end of the 1982 season. He continued his football success with the Miami Dolphins as quarterback. He retired from the Dolphins in 2000 after a 17-year career. Marino was inducted into the College Football Hall of Fame in 2003 and the Pro Football Hall of Fame in 2005.
